Government needs more competent contractors for 2016 infra projects

Photo courtesy of imgkid.com

The Department of Public Works and Highways is in need of more qualified and well equipped contractors to carry out the proposed P357 Billion worth of projects in the 2016 national spending plan for public infrastructure development.

DPWH allocation for infrastructure for 2016 has increased by 30% or P84 Billion from the P273.9 Billion budget in 2015 as part of the government’s determined efforts to further boost the infrastructure investment.

DPWH Secretary Rogelio L. Singson said that construction industry in the Philippines has a positive future especially for those contractors with Philippine Contractor’s Accreditation Board (PCAB) licenses.

However, the prospective contractors have to conform to project’s equipment resources, financial and expertise requirements, technical personnel and to demonstrate competence in terms of ability to participate in competitive public bidding, added Singson.

Republic Act 4566 otherwise known as the Contractor’s License Law as amended by Presidential Decree No. 1746 provides that no contractor (including sub-contractor and specialty contractor) shall engage in the business of contracting without first having secured a PCAB license to conduct business.

Although a regular license will automatically qualify the licensee to participate in private projects, a contractor will have to apply for registration with the DPWH Civil Works Registry of Contractors.

Under next year’s proposed infrastructure spending plan, Northern Mindanao (Region 10) will receive the biggest slice of the budget with P30.14 Billion, followed by Central Luzon (Region 3), P25.21 Billion; Southern Tagalog (Region 4-A), P21.28 Billion; Eastern Visayas (Region 8), P20.68 Billion; National Capital Region, P19.7 Billion; Bicol Region (Region 5), P19.65 Billion; Southern Mindanao (Region 11), P18.96 Billion; Western Mindanao (Region 9), P18.59 Billion; Western Visayas (Region 6), P17.84 Billion; CARAGA (Region 13), P16.99 Billion; Central Visayas (Region 7), P16.96 Billion; MIMAROPA (Region 4-B), P16.40 Billion; Ilocos Region (Region 1), P14.97 Billion; Central Mindanao (Region 12), P12.64 Billion; Cagayan Valley (Region 2), P12.41 Billion; and Cordillera Administrative Region, P12.36 Billion.

An additional amount of P64 Billion is also allotted for inter-regional and other nationwide projects.

DPWH has combined budgets of P427.5 Billion from FY 2006 to 2010 and P799.35 Billion from CY 2011 to FY 2015.
